    From the FAQ.
    -------------
    What are the points and money per race?
    Basically this is very simple:

    You get 2.000.000 per race regardless if you scored any points just having a complete team is enough.

    You can earn some extra cash when you guessed the pole time right. The more accurate you are the more money you earn.

    You get 50.000 per point you score with your complete team (incomplete teams don't get points)

    You get points for all of your team items (driver 1, driver 2, chassis and engine).

    Only the first 10 in the qualify and the race get points.

    The point distribution is as follows:
    Qualify: (Drivers)
    1. 25
    2. 18
    3. 15
    4. 12
    5. 10
    6. 8
    7. 6
    8. 4
    9. 2
    10.1

    Race (Drivers)
    1. 50
    2. 36
    3. 30
    4. 24
    5. 20
    6. 16
    7. 12
    8. 8
    9. 4
    10.2

    Qualify & Race: (Chassis and Engine)
    1. 25
    2. 18
    3. 15
    4. 12
    5. 10
    6. 8
    7. 6
    8. 4
    9. 2
    10.1


    The pole time allows you to estimate the pole position time of the Q3 qualification. When you fill in the pole time very accuratly you can earn some extra budget for the race. You don't get any points for it.

    When guessing the pole time very accuratly you can earn some serious extra budget:
    Difference in ms - Budget
    0 - 10.000.000
    <11 - 2.000.000
    <51 - 1.500.000
    <101 - 1.000.000
    <201 - 750.000
    <301 - 500.000
    <401 - 250.000
    <501 - 100.000

    If you are off more than half second you don't earn any extra money.

    Well it's not so difficult, and I'm happy to coach a bit.

    You're not going to be competing for top honors unless you start at race 1; on the other hand, you could get some familiarization ready for the start of next year. Also, if a few guys start now, you can compete between each other.

    You get a budget of $100M and you only score anything if you enter a complete team. The cheapest possible team is $21M + $22M + $23M + $23M = $89M leaving $11M of discretionary budget available for upgrades. Trades cost you 10% of the item you sell, so a fee of between $2M and $5M per trade; so you don't want to be trading willy-nilly.

    The two viable starting strategies are:

    - the boring one. Buy the $89M team and collect $2M appearance money each race until you can afford a high points scoring engine or chassis

    - the more interesting one. Spend the extra $11M to get the best engine or chassis you can afford (hint: Williams or Force India chassis) and hope you accumulate more prize money than you lose on your trades, and hope that you don't have to wait an extra race or two to trade up to Mercedes etc. which would normally bring in the big money and points.

    So you are pretty much not going to be managing your roster the majority of weeks in the first half of the season.

    What you will be doing is checking the practice times and putting in your pole time estimate before the start of Qually 1 in the hope of picking up that pole time bonus and thereby enabling that Mercedes update that little bit sooner (unless, of course, you decide that your Williams / Force India is actually going to score more than Mercedes )
